Subject: [PATCH] doc: fix typo in feature-removal-schedule
Date: Wed, 19 Dec 2007 01:46:53 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20071219014653.07378245@morte> (raw)
Signed-off-by: Stefano Brivio <stefano.brivio@polimi.it>
---
Index: wireless-2.6/Documentation/feature-removal-schedule.txt
===================================================================
--- wireless-2.6.orig/Documentation/feature-removal-schedule.txt
+++ wireless-2.6/Documentation/feature-removal-schedule.txt
@@ -343,7 +343,7 @@ Who: John W. Linville <linville@tuxdrive
---------------------------
-What: iee80211 softmac wireless networking component
+What: ieee80211 softmac wireless networking component
When: 2.6.26 (or after removal of bcm43xx and port of zd1211rw to mac80211)
Files: net/ieee80211/softmac
Why: No in-kernel drivers will depend on it any longer.
